基于OPENGL的物理力学模拟实验课件的设计与实现
多媒体教学课件正在被越来越多地开发和应用,但目前大多数课件是用比较简单的二维图形技术生成,只能简单地示意物体运动的特征,不能逼真地反映出在三维环境中物体运动的规律.本文利用虚拟技术中的三维图形技术,用C++ Builder和Open GL技术编程实现了物理力学的若干三维模拟实验课件,并在大学物理教学中得到应用.这些模拟实验课件不仅可以使教学内容更加生动形象,而且还能模拟常规物理实验难以实现的实验条件和效果.本文介绍了根据物理数学模型构建数据结构的方法,给出了如何使用模型变换、投影变换、视口变换以及消隐技术等绘制场景和运动物体,还介绍了光照和纹理的产生方法以及动画性能的优化措施等.本文所介绍的多媒体课件设计方法具有程序开发周期短、物体运动真实感强、程序运行速度快等特点.
虚拟现实 三维图形 OPENGL 物理力学实验 多媒体课件
夏京城 徐敏 刘其真
复旦大学计算机科学与工程系(上海)
国内会议
上海
中文
763-766
2003-10-01(万方平台首次上网日期,不代表论文的发表时间)